Smart Contract Interaction: The Heart of Multi-Chain DeFi
Smart contracts are the backbone of DeFi, but their complexity can be intimidating. When you’re dealing with multiple chains, each with its own virtual machine quirks and transaction rules, the challenge multiplies. I won’t lie, sometimes it feels like juggling flaming swords while blindfolded.
Most wallets focus on signing transactions, but few offer deep smart contract interaction capabilities out of the box. This is a big deal because successful cross-chain swaps often require atomic transactions—either all parts succeed, or none do. Otherwise, you risk losing funds or ending up with partial swaps. FAQ
What exactly are cross-chain swaps?
Cross-chain swaps allow you to exchange tokens directly between different blockchains without needing to use centralized exchanges. They work through smart contracts that coordinate the swap to ensure both sides complete successfully or not at all.
How does smart contract interaction improve wallet security?
By enabling users to see and approve each smart contract call explicitly, wallets reduce the risk of unknowingly authorizing malicious transactions. This transparency and control layer is essential when dealing with complex multi-chain protocols.
Is liquidity mining safe?
It depends. While liquidity mining can be lucrative, it carries risks such as impermanent loss, smart contract bugs, and potential rug pulls. Using wallets with strong security features and well-audited protocols helps mitigate these risks.
